Overview

The AI Solution Architect II is responsible for the architecture, engineering, and production operationalization of enterprise AI solutions, ensuring they are scalable, secure, and performant. This role leverages methodologies, frameworks, tools, and platforms to architect and implement AI platforms, pipelines, and solution patterns that meet business objectives. The AI Architect ensures standardization, reuse, integration, quality, and lifecycle manageability of AI architectures through close coordination with technology, data, and enterprise architects.

The position involves deep technical evaluation of AI/ML models and platforms, integration into Cleco’s enterprise IT landscape, collaboration with cybersecurity teams, and support for testing and quality assurance processes.
